Each time you use this cookware, allow it to cool down afterwards and then clean it thoroughly.
Your cookware is handwash only. Always hand dry with a soft towel immediately.
Do not put in the dishwasher.
To bring back the shine to the copper, use a sponge and soak with a special copper cleaning product (e.g. Copperbrill) - simply apply a small amount to a sponge or soft cloth, rinse with water and dry thoroughly.
Do not use abrasive steel wool or nylon scouring sponges. This will damage the copper.
Do not use oven cleaners, aggressive cleaning products or products containing chlorine bleach.
Ensure that no hard particles become stuck to the heat source or the underside of the pan, to avoid scratching the hob.
Never store cookware alongside sharp metal utensils. This is because they can cause scratches on the outside of cookware finished with copper. Always ensure the cookware is clean before storing.
Always take care when stacking cookware. We advise you to use pan protectors.
